10 Ways to Spend Quality Time in Nature This Summer

Summer is the perfect time to soak up some fresh air. Being outside can boost your mood and encourage physical activity, which can be more of a challenge during colder months.

If you spend all day working in an office, commuting home and doing chores, it might seem hard to find time and energy to go outside. However, getting vitamin D and connecting with nature can help ease the stress of daily life. Working outdoor time into your schedule will be well worth it.

Whether you’re looking for weekend adventures or small activities you can fit into a busy day, there are plenty of ways to spend quality time in nature this summer.
